Understanding Stretch Marks: The Science Unveiled

Before we dive into the remedies, let’s grasp a deeper understanding of what stretch marks are and why they appear. Stretch marks, medically known as striae, are a form of scarring on the skin that emerges when the skin undergoes rapid stretching or shrinking. They often manifest as long, narrow streaks or lines and may exhibit a different texture and color compared to the surrounding skin.

The Mechanics Behind Pregnancy Stretch Marks

During pregnancy, as your body nurtures the growing life within, your skin stretches significantly to accommodate your baby’s development. This rapid stretching creates tension on the skin’s underlying structure, leading to the breakdown of collagen and elastin fibers in the dermis – the second layer of the skin. As a result, stretch marks surface on areas like the abdomen, hips, thighs, and breasts.

Numerous factors contribute to the development of stretch marks during pregnancy, including hormonal changes, genetics, and the amount of weight gained throughout the gestation period. While these marks are a natural consequence of pregnancy, many mothers seek effective ways to minimize their appearance postpartum.

Understanding the Benefits and Limitations of Coconut Oil for Stretch Marks

Coconut oil is often hailed for its potential benefits in improving skin health and addressing various skin concerns, including stretch marks. Here are the key points to consider when using coconut oil for this purpose:

  1. Moisturization Power: Coconut oil’s fatty acids make it an effective moisturizer. Applying it to the skin can enhance hydration and combat dryness, resulting in smoother and more supple skin.
  2. Soothing Properties: The anti-inflammatory characteristics of coconut oil can soothe irritated skin and alleviate redness and itching commonly associated with stretch marks.
  3. Natural Appeal: Many people prefer coconut oil for its natural origin and lack of synthetic additives or harsh chemicals, making it a popular choice for skin care.
  4. Early Intervention: When applied to new stretch marks, coconut oil may help maintain skin moisture and suppleness, potentially reducing the severity of fresh stretch marks.
  5. Limits with Mature Stretch Marks: While coconut oil can improve overall skin appearance, it may not lead to significant fading of mature stretch marks.
  6. Individual Response: The effectiveness of coconut oil can vary from person to person, with some individuals experiencing more noticeable improvements than others.
  7. Enhancing Results: Coconut oil can complement other natural remedies or medical treatments for stretch marks, potentially enhancing the overall outcome.
  8. Realistic Expectations: It’s essential to have realistic expectations when using coconut oil for stretch marks, as complete removal of stretch marks through topical treatments alone may not be possible.
  9. Consider Other Options: For more substantial improvements in stretch marks’ appearance, medical treatments such as laser therapy, microdermabrasion, or chemical peels may be worth exploring.
  10. Professional Guidance: Before starting any treatment, especially medical procedures, consulting a dermatologist or healthcare provider is advisable to ensure the treatment is safe and suitable for your specific skin type and condition.

How do celebrities get rid of stretch marks?

  1. Topical Creams and Oils: Celebrities often explore specialized creams, lotions, or oils containing ingredients like retinoids, hyaluronic acid, vitamin E, or natural oils such as coconut oil, rosehip seed oil, or almond oil. These products aim to moisturize the skin and potentially improve the appearance of stretch marks over time.
  2. Laser Therapy: Some celebrities opt for laser treatments like fractional laser therapy or pulsed dye laser, which stimulate collagen production and promote skin healing. Laser therapy can potentially reduce redness and fade stretch marks.
  3. Microneedling: Microneedling involves creating controlled micro-injuries in the skin using tiny needles, stimulating collagen production and potentially improving the texture and appearance of stretch marks.
  4. Chemical Peels: Mild chemical peels, containing alpha-hydroxy acids (AHAs) or other agents, can exfoliate the skin and promote cell turnover, potentially reducing the visibility of stretch marks.
  5. Microdermabrasion: This procedure uses tiny crystals to exfoliate the skin’s outer layer, which may improve its texture and reduce the visibility of stretch marks.
  6. Cosmetic Camouflage: For temporary solutions, celebrities may use makeup or body makeup to conceal stretch marks during public appearances or photoshoots.
  7. Time and Patience: Many celebrities, like anyone else, acknowledge that time and patience play a significant role in managing stretch marks. With time, stretch marks may naturally fade and become less noticeable.
